L-Glutamine Alcohol inhibits the availability of glucose through an insulin-mediated mechanism. L-Glutamine contain a sulfhydryl group of sulfur effective in scavenging acetaldehyde and to help the liver manufacture glutathione, one of the body’s most important natural detoxifiers.
Korean Ginseng Herb used in Asia for generations as a general tonic to increase energy, stamina and vitality. It has a beneficial influence on the cardiovascular system, helping regulate blood pressure and cardiac rhythm. It also regulates the nervous system and increases alertness and energy.

Guarana The guarana berry is cultivated in the Amazon. It has been consumed by the Amazon naitons for centuries for its stimulating effect on mind and body. Pure guarana powder is an ideal herb to maintain stamina and ward off fatigue and stress. It has been reported that long terms administration of guarana has proven to act as a potent stimulator of brain functions with significant positive effect on cognition.

Inositol Inositol, an insomer of glucose, has traditionally been considered to be a vitamin B substance. Sources of Inocitol include whole-grain cereals, fruits and plants, in which it occurs as the hexaphophate, phytic acid. Inositol appears to be involved physiologically in lipid metabolism. Inositol is required for proper formation of cell membranes and nerve transporting.
